ColumbusvsTarget

Columbus (dual purpose) and Target (bittering) serve different purposes. Comparing acids, aromas and character helps pick the right hop.

Key differences

When to pick Columbus

  • Higher alpha acid - stronger bittering
  • More essential oils - more intense aroma
  • Versatile - works for both bittering and aroma
  • Richer, more complex aroma profile

When to pick Target

  • Bittering workhorse - efficient in the mash

Property

PropertyColumbusTarget
Alpha acid14–18%8.5–13.5%
Beta acid4.5–6%4.3–5.7%
Co-humulone28–35%35–40%
Total oil2.5–4.5 mL1–1.4 mL
Myrcene45–55%45–55%
Humulene9–14%17–23%
Caryophyllene6–10%8–10%
Farnesene0–1%0–1%
OriginUnited StatesUnited Kingdom
PurposeDual purposeBittering
